Fish Creek was a railway station on the South Gippsland line in South Gippsland, Victoria. The station was opened during the 1890s and operated until 1992 when the line to Barry Beach servicing the oil fields in Bass Strait was closed. The line was then dismantled and turned into the Great Southern Rail Trail. Fish Creek contained a rather extensive goods yard, all of which now has been demolished. The remaining platform is still in good condition.
